Layonne HolmesLayonne Holmes is a performing and session vocalist currently leading The Motor City Revue Motown Tribute. She also sings backup for Darlene Love and the Matt O'Ree Band and sang with Jon Bon Jovi's solo project, Jon Bon Jovi & The Kings of Suburbia. Leah Faith HariegelLeah is 12 years old and is a student at St. Rose Grammar School. She studies voice with Lauren Greco and is a student at Count Basie Turner Academy for the Arts. She is very involved in musical theater. Credits include Ariel in The Little Mermaid, Mrs. Bucket in Willy Wonka, Susan Waverly in White Christmas and Dragon In Shrek, among others. Leah was a finalist in Laurita Idol competitions. She has sung The National Anthem for the Monmouth County Government events and has sung at numerous fundraisers including Kick Cancer Overboard and Autism awareness. Leah is thrilled to be a part of this amazing fundraising cause.

Kim DuncanKim is a private piano teacher in Point Pleasant. She has been teaching for over 40 years and has had several students perform in Carnegie Hall and Lincoln Center over the years. She co-wrote a musical with Steve Frank and Rich Gelbstien that was a winner in the 2012 New York Musical Festival called “Legaleeze” aka: “Howe and Hummel the Musical. ” She has students recording in New York, at the Jersey Shore and in Nashville performing both locally and across the country including Fran O’Brien of the Gab Cinque Band, Matthew Testa of the Vibrotones and Grady Wenrich of the Lonely Biscuits. She is currently writing music and looking forward to playing out again.
